Technical Aspects
Use of Camera
In the video there are many Medium close ups on the band members, long shots of the full band, high angle shots, tracking shots from when they are driving in their car. The camera tends to be still for most of the video unless they are in the car. The aspects of the camera use that is particularly effective are the high angle shot when the singer is looking into the camera and when they band are in the car driving round in the city. Another effective use of the camera is when they are on the beach and are fighting with the surfers as the camera goes from extreme long shots to medium and when they go to hit the surfer on the ground, the camera shot is a point of view shot and you see the band members fist swing into the camera. I believe this is effective because it shows the band are in your face and they are serious about becoming musical artists.

Editing
The cut rate in this video is very fast so that it can show everything in the video that they wanted to be in it. Effects in the editing consist of slow motion on some of the scenes, e.g. Playing golf on the beach and when they are doing cartwheels. The lip synching is in time with when the actual song lyrics are singing and is performed very will in this. There isnt much cutting to the beat in this song, one of the only times it does it is when the diver jumps into the swimming pool and it shows him being in different places when jumping into the pool by putting 4 squares onto the screen and each square appears on each hit of the snare every two hits.

OK Go – Background Information.


OK Go is a Grammy Award winning rock band from Chicago, Illinois, who formed in 1998. The band is made up of Damian Kulash (lead vocals and guitar), Tim Nordwind (bass guitar and vocals), Dan Konopka (drums and percussion) and Andy Ross (guitar, keyboards and vocals), who joined them in 2005, replacing Andy Duncan.


A picture of the band:


The bands name ‘OK Go’ originated from when Damian and Tim were at a art’s camp when they were 11 and their art teacher, saying "OK...Go!" while they were drawing.


Since the band started in 1998 they have released 11 singles and 3 albums. However the main success of the

band has come from their music videos, which have had their success from YouTube and become viral videos.

The video "Here It Goes Again", where the band performed a complex a strange and unique dance routine with the aid of motorized treadmills, has received over 52 million YouTube hits.

The music video can be seen in a previous blog post.


Since then they have released several different music videos each of them being unique and bringing something new to music video industry.


Their latest single and music video 'White Knuckles' has once again been a huge hit and has had over 5 million YouTube hits within 10 days. This time the video features the band members performing choreographed actions with minimal props alongside a number of trained dogs and one goat, with the actions set in time to the song.
